Term |
visceral muscle cell |
ID (Ontology) |
FBbt:00005070 (Fly Anatomy) |
Definition |
Muscle cell of a muscle that moves the viscera and has only one or, commonly no attachment to the body wall. Visceral muscles differ from somatic muscles in several respects: adjacent fibers are held together by desmosomes, each fiber is uninucleate and the contractile material is not grouped into fibrils but packs the whole fiber. Visceral muscles appear striated. The visceral musculature comprises circular and longitudinal fibers which surround the entire intestinal tract, with the exception of the recurrent layer of the proventriculus, and ducts of the reproductive system. The circular fibers derive from a bilaterally symmetrical band of mesodermal cells extending continuously throughout most of the germ band. The longitudinal fibers derive from clusters of mesodermal cells which appear during stage 12 at the posterior end of the embryo and migrate anteriorly.[ FlyBase:FBrf0064793 FlyBase:FBrf0089570 FlyBase:FBrf0239227 ] |
Comment |
It is quite common to refer to visceral muscles as smooth muscles, by analogy with vertebrates; however most visceral muscles in Drosophila are actually striated (Bate, 1993 - FBrf0064793). |
